Key Points:

  • San Francisco 49ers wide receiver De'Zhaun Stribling underwent surgery for a deltoid ligament sprain in his left ankle sustained during the season opener against the Los Angeles Rams.
  • Head coach Kyle Shanahan expects Stribling to be sidelined for approximately 10 weeks but is optimistic he will return before the season ends.
  • Stribling, the No. 33 overall pick in this year's NFL draft, had shown strong preseason performance with notable receptions and yards, earning a starting role alongside Mike Evans and Deebo Samuel.
  • The former Ole Miss player impressed during training camp and early games, indicating potential to justify the 49ers' second-round investment despite initial perceptions of being a draft reach.
  • While the injury is a setback, it is not season-ending, allowing Stribling the opportunity to contribute later in the season.
